Bewafa Bar is a song with atmosphere. I heard it once long ago and at some inadvertent moment it pops out from the recesses of my mind and sends a whiff of air through the cobwebs.
‘Bewafa’ means the ‘Betrayer’, here referring to the lover who betrays.
At first glance it might seem an odd song to remember and recollect. But to me it has got lots going for it: Adnan Sami (need I say more) + a nice tune + the unshaven Sanjay Dutt who so fits the character of a betrayed lover + what I think are authentic bar dancers who create a great atmosphere and dance with passion (thank god the Shiamak Davar clones are not around. These girls are so much more authentic and earthy)
